OBJECTIVES OF RASHTRIYA GRAM SWARAJ ABHIYAN

The objectives and key features of Revamped Rashtriya Gram Swaraj Abhiyan (RGSA) are as under:
- Develop the capacity of elected representatives of PRIs for leadership Roles to enable the Gram Panchayats to function effectively as third tier of Government;
- Strengthening Gram Sabhas to function effectively as the basic forum of people's participation within the Panchayat system.
- Promote e-governance and other technology driven solutions to enable good governance in Panchayat administrative efficiency and improved service delivery with transparency and accountability;
- Promote devolution of powers and responsibilities to Panchayats according to the spirit of the Constitution and PESA Act 1996; etc.
The erstwhile Rashtriya Gram SwarajAbhiyan was implemented for the period of 2018-19 to 2021-22 and subsequently the Scheme has been revamped for implementation during the period FY 2022-23 to 2025-26 in co-terminus with 15th Finance Commission. The total financial outlay of revamped RGSA scheme for the period FY 2022-23 to FY 2025-26 is Rs. 5911 crore in which Central Share is Rs 3700 Crore and State matching Share is Rs. 2211 crore. An external evaluation of the Revamped RGSA has been undertaken through the Institute of Rural Management, Anand (IRMA). The study conducted a large-scale field survey covering 600 Gram Panchayats across 120 blocks in 60 districts of 16 States, engaging over 6,000 stakeholders, including Elected Representatives, Panchayat Functionaries, line department officials, trainers/faculty, and State/District RGSA units. In addition, NITI Aayog has commissioned an independent assessment of RGSA to provide complementary evidence on outcomes. The evaluations indicate that the scheme’s structured, multi-layered capacity-building, combining classroom/thematic modules, exposure visits and digital learning, has enhanced PRI capacities in Panchayat operations, planning and implementation (including GPDP), digital governance, citizen engagement and financial management. Post-training assessments record measurable gains in knowledge and practice, supporting more effective local governance and the Localisation of SDGs.
The implementation of the scheme is closely monitored through meetings and video conferences with State officials, and field visits by senior officers. The Central Empowered Committee (CEC) of RGSA, while approving a State’s Annual Action Plan (AAP), considers the progress of implementation and the utilisation of funds. States/UTs are regularly reminded to furnish the requisite documents, including Utilisation Certificates (UCs) and Auditor’s Reports, in accordance with Ministry of Finance instructions, for the regulation of fund releases.
The scheme is being implemented since financial year 2022-23 in States/ UTs with main objective of capacitating Panchayati Raj institutions (PRIs) through imparting training to the Elected Representatives (ERs), functionaries and other stakeholders to develop their governance capabilities for leadership roles to enable the Panchayats to function effectively. Under revamped RGSA scheme, capacity building and training of elected representatives, functionaries and other stakeholders of Panchayats supported under different categories viz. basic orientation and refresher training, thematic training, specialized training, panchayat development plan training, etc. Apart from different trainings, scheme also supports for exposure visits of Elected Representatives and Panchayat Functionaries, development of training modules and materials, etc.
In addition, a new initiative has also been taken for capacity building and training of elected representatives and functionaries of Panchayats through institutes of excellence under Leadership/Management Development Program (MDP). Ministry also organizes workshop on different subjects and sharing of best practices for cross State learning.
Under the scheme of revamped RGSA, computers are provided on limited scales for digital enablement of Gram Panchayats. Further, the Ministry runs various web based portal like eGramSwaraj, Gram Manchitra, Meri Panchayat App which facilitate Panchayati Raj Institutions for decentralised planning, transparent fund-flow & expenditure tracking, asset & works management, and citizen-centric governance.
